Another
casualty of political folly...
Now that Atlantis Diesel Engines (ADE) is no more, has
anyone given a thought to the workforce who helped make
it happen. It seems not writes our Cape correspondent,
Stephanie Platt, after a visit to the once famous area
that played host to the engine house of the South
African trucking, military and agricultural industries. |

Trucking the
bananas...
If you think farming bananas is an idyllic existence in a sub-tropical paradise, you are dead wrong! A visit to Umbhaba Estates in Hazyview, Mpumalang by FleetWatch's Dave Scott is a real eye-opener for anyone who casually unzips a banana every day for breakfast. It also shows how trucking is the key to the success of this operation.

Shaking off the AMC
dust...
Being linked by name to Afinta Motor Corporation is a bad move - as Wayne Lodder and David Robertson, co-owners of Afintapart, have found out through bitter experience. In this article, Patrick O'Leary talks to Lodder on the company's attempts to shake off its link to the AMC name.
